Step 4: Bring up the Quillmark schema registry before any producers start. Verify the compatibility mode is set to BACKWARD, confirm the health endpoint returns ready, and check that replica counts match the Thornefield cluster spec. The registry authenticates producers with a shared credential; place it in the env file on the following line.

sealed setting: ARCHIVE_KEY3=8d0

Before archiving any cold storage bucket in the Glacierline tier, verify that the retention ledger in Vaultkeeper shows zero active legal holds. Run the manifest diff against the last successful archive snapshot and confirm checksums match before proceeding. Archival jobs must be submitted through the Corvid scheduler, never directly against the storage API, since direct writes bypass the audit trail. The scheduler requires authentication against the internal Corvid endpoint, so pass the key below with every submission request.

API key for tagef-fafop: vxb2-ta

Subject: Quickstore 4.2 — bloom filter now fronts the KV layer

Plugin authors: starting with this release, Quickstore places a bloom filter ahead of the key-value store. Negative lookups return faster; false positives fall through safely. No API changes are required on your side. Verify your plugin against the staging build referenced below.

session token of fahif-tadup = htk3_9c7

TURN-208: Gatevale turnstile counters at the Merrow Field pilot double-count when a rotation reverses mid-cycle. Attendance totals drift roughly 2% high per event. The debounce window fix is implemented, reviewed by Ilsa, and soak-tested across two simulated match days without drift. Ready for your cut; the candidate build is identified below.

trace token, tagag-tafog: htk6_5ed18c